Ellensburg Park Named For Fallen Sheriff’s Deputy

An Ellensburg park is renamed in memory of a fallen Kittital County Sheriff’s deputy who had a passion for the outdoors. Deputy Ryan Thompson was shot and killed during a March 2019 shootout with a gunman in the town of Kittitas. No In Person Classes Again At MLSD

For a third day in a row Moses Lake students will be all distance-learning because of unhealthy air quality. MLSD administrators say the threshold in allowing students to return in in-person learning is an Air Quality Indication reading of ‘200’ or less at the start of the day. No Need To Request A Ballot

Secretary of State Kim Wyman said there is no need to request a mail-in ballot for the November election as was suggest by a recent U.S. Postal Service mailing. Fire Update

Work continues to contain the Pearl Hill fire in Douglas County and the Cold Springs Canyon fire. Full contaiment of the 223,000 acre Pearl Hill fire is expected to be achieved today while the Cold Springs Canyon fire is at 50% containment.
